Angular2 De Routage. Le chemin demandé contient pas défini segment à l'index 1

J'ai un problème avec le routage dans Angulaire 2.
J'appelle routeur.naviguer à partir d'une action dans une datatable. Le rare est que, parfois, quand je clique sur le bouton qui appelle cette ligne fonctionne très bien et parfois il ne marche pas.

this.router.navigate(['edit', id], {relativeTo: this.activatedRoute});

L'erreur qui montre l'inspecteur d'élément est:

The requested path contains undefined segment at index 1

Im en utilisant Angular2, tables de données, et Webpack

Mise à jour -> le problème est que, parfois, lire l'id et parfois pas. Donc, le problème est avec les tables de données.

OriginalL'auteur Matias graña | 2017-04-08